@import "https://fonts.googleapis.com/css2?family=Inter:wght@400;500;600;700&family=Manrope:wght@600;700;800&display=swap";
:root{--primary:#836ea0;--on-primary:#fff;--secondary:#7d7389;--tertiary:#996984;--on-tertiary:#fff;--neutral:#7a767b;--surface:#fbf8fd;--surface-container-low:#f3f0f5;--surface-container-lowest:#fdfcff;--surface-container-high:#ebe7ee;--surface-container-highest:#e3dfe7;--on-surface:#3a383b;--shadow-diffused:0 24px 48px -12px #7a767b1f;--radius-level-1:8px;--radius-level-2:16px;--radius-level-3:24px}.text-display-lg{letter-spacing:-.02em;font-family:Manrope,sans-serif;font-size:3.5rem;font-weight:800;line-height:1.1}.text-display-md{letter-spacing:-.02em;font-family:Manrope,sans-serif;font-size:2.5rem;font-weight:700;line-height:1.2}.text-headline-lg{font-family:Manrope,sans-serif;font-size:2rem;font-weight:700;line-height:1.2}.text-headline-md{font-family:Manrope,sans-serif;font-size:1.5rem;font-weight:600;line-height:1.3}.text-body-lg{font-family:Inter,sans-serif;font-size:1rem;font-weight:400;line-height:1.5}.text-body-md{font-family:Inter,sans-serif;font-size:.875rem;font-weight:400;line-height:1.5}.text-label-sm{letter-spacing:.08em;text-transform:uppercase;font-family:Manrope,sans-serif;font-size:.75rem;font-weight:800;line-height:1.3}.text-technical-label{letter-spacing:.15em;text-transform:uppercase;font-family:Manrope,sans-serif;font-size:.625rem;font-weight:800;line-height:1.2}.font-data-mono{font-family:ui-monospace,SFMono-Regular,Menlo,Monaco,Consolas,monospace;font-size:.875rem;font-weight:500}.btn-primary{background-color:var(--primary);color:var(--on-primary);border-radius:var(--radius-level-1);justify-content:center;align-items:center;gap:.5rem;text-decoration:none;display:inline-flex}.btn-primary:hover{filter:brightness(1.1)}.card-lowest{background-color:var(--surface-container-lowest);border-radius:var(--radius-level-2)}.glass-nav{-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);background-color:#fbf8fdcc;border-bottom:1px solid #7a767b14}.input-technical{background-color:var(--surface-container-low);border-radius:var(--radius-level-2);color:var(--on-surface);border:1px solid #7a767b26;width:100%;padding:.875rem 1.25rem;font-family:Inter,sans-serif}.input-technical.has-icon-left{padding-left:3rem!important}.input-technical::placeholder{color:var(--neutral);opacity:.5}.input-technical:focus{border-color:var(--primary);background-color:var(--surface-container-lowest);outline:none;box-shadow:0 0 0 4px #836ea01a,0 12px 24px -8px #836ea033}select.input-technical{appearance:none;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' fill='none' viewBox='0 0 24 24' stroke='%23836ea0'%3E%3Cpath stroke-linecap='round' stroke-linejoin='round' stroke-width='2' d='M19 9l-7 7-7-7'%3E%3C/path%3E%3C/svg%3E");background-position:right 1rem center;background-repeat:no-repeat;background-size:1.25rem;padding-right:2.5rem}
